# Log sampling config — Murmurjet service
# Murmurjet is extremely chatty. Default sample rate: 1% for INFO,
# 100% for WARN and above. Do not raise INFO sampling in prod
# without release-manager sign-off; last time it tripled ingest costs.
# Per-route overrides live in the overrides table, keyed by route name.
# The sampler polls that table every 60 seconds; changes take effect
# without a restart. Note for the release cut: verify overrides are
# empty before tagging. The sampler reads overrides using the
# connection string below.

replica DSN, tawef-hahap: mysql://eliix_svc:FiIC0jz@db-394a.lumiclabs.internal:5432/holius

As of the Q3 release, Ledgermoor's payroll export switched from fixed-width files to the new columnar format consumed by the Brightquay benefits system. The old service account used for the legacy drop folder has been retired. Support staff investigating missing export runs should check the Brightquay ingest logs first; most failures are format mismatches from outdated templates. If you need to manually re-trigger an export, the internal export API accepts authenticated requests only. Authenticate those re-trigger calls with the key below.

gateway credential: kto23_LX9A4ys6i4nzHtpOLNLodKK

# Break-Glass: Catalog Cache Invalidation

Scope: the Pinrow product catalog at Veldstone Retail. If stale prices persist after a purge and the Hollowmere invalidation queue is wedged, use break-glass to flush the edge tier directly. Contractors: get verbal sign-off from the catalog lead first. Steps: open the Hollowmere admin shell, select emergency-flush, confirm the tenant, and run it once — repeated flushes thrash the origin. Access is logged and expires after 20 minutes. Unseal the admin shell with the passphrase below.

recovery phrase for kahop-tajog: istix-casvan

## Further Reading

Sweeper, our stale-branch cleanup bot, deletes branches with no commits in 60 days unless they carry the keep label or match a protected pattern. Before proposing changes at the sync, please review the retention matrix, the exemption workflow, and the restore procedure, since deleted branches remain recoverable for 30 days via the archive mirror. The complete policy document, including edge cases discussed last quarter, lives on the internal page here.

wiki page, faweg-bagef: https://rundeck.torvaworks.example/spaces/repo/repo/view/7fb98d667a378114